KW-HIA Calls for Enhanced Health Insurance Awareness in Irepodun LGA

Date: 2025-02-06

The Kwara State Health Insurance Agency (KW-HIA) has called for increased awareness campaigns regarding the benefits of enrolling in the state health insurance scheme at the local government level.

Mrs Olubunmi Jetawo-Winter, Executive Secretary of KW-HIA, made this appeal on Wednesday during a courtesy visit to the Chairman of Irepodun Local Government Area, Hon. Abdulazeez Yakubu, in Omu-Aran. She highlighted the critical role that health insurance plays in ensuring access to quality healthcare services, particularly during periods of economic difficulty.

Mrs Jetawo-Winter urged for greater sensitisation efforts among residents of Irepodun, praising the chairman for his exceptional leadership and performance amidst the current economic challenges facing the country. She also commended his governance achievements and encouraged him to maintain his dedication to the development of the local government area.

Reaponding, Hon. Abdulazeez Yakubu appreciated Mrs. Jetawo-Winter for the visit and pledged the local government's cooperation in promoting the health insurance scheme.

Yakubu reaffirmed his administration's dedication to improving the welfare of the people, stating that health remained a top priority in his agenda.

He said the visit underscored the importance of synergy between local government authorities and health agencies in achieving universal health coverage for Kwara residents.
